Initial tablet POC: project restructure + WebSocket/HTTP server + JS client
- Restructured project into /app, /server, /client with run.py entry point - WSServer (QWebSocketServer) with log_signal, start/stop, client tracking - HTTP server serves /client on port 8080 - Vanilla JS client: faders, toggles, transport, drag-to-arrange, lock/save layout - Start Tablet button + floating Tablet log window in app UI - Preset broadcast on load/switch, DAW state relay, hardware sync via widget_update - Widget colors synced from app palette, toggle state fixed (sends 0/127 correctly) - Layout saved per preset UUID back to presets.json Co-Authored-By: Claude Sonnet 4.6 <noreply@anthropic.com>
